ESPN’s Adrian Wojnarowski is reporting that Denver Nuggets assistant coach Wes Unseld Jr. and Milwaukee Bucks assistant coach Darvin Ham are the front-runners in the Wizards’ coaching search.

Bucks assistant Charles Lee also has emerged as a finalist for the job, sources said.

Unseld, who has served as a Nuggets assistant since 2015, was an assistant coach for the Wizards from 2005 to 2011. He was considered a top contender to coach the Orlando Magic, though they hired Jamahl Mosley from the Dallas Mavericks earlier this week, and was a runner-up for the Chicago Bulls job last offseason.
